The giant countries of Europe, often referred to in terms of land area and population, include Russia, which is the largest country in the world and spans both Europe and Asia. Other large European nations are Ukraine and France, which are significant in size and geopolitical influence. Germany and Spain also rank among the larger countries in Europe by area. These countries play key roles in European politics, economy, and culture.

Switzerland is the most mountainous country in Europe. It stands out for its high peaks, including the famous Alps, which cover a significant portion of the country and offer stunning landscapes and opportunities for outdoor activities like skiing and hiking.
The Canary Islands are politically part of Spain, which is in Europe. However, in terms of geography, they are part of the continent of Africa.
